This page shows businesses on Lancaster Road. Click on a business to bring up its details and a map showing its location.
Builder
Address: 36 Lancaster Road, Maidenhead, Berkshire, SL6 5EP
Bricklaying
Address: 34 Lancaster Road, Maidenhead, Berkshire, SL6 5EP
Map showing Lancaster Road in Maidenhead.